Small Business Liability Insurance

If you own a business and a mishap occurs, a lawsuit can quickly end your career as a proprietor. Your assets, such as your home, can also be in danger if a lawsuit against your business is successful. Therefore, small business liability insurance is a must. It need not cost you an excessive amount. As they say, it’s much better to be safe than to be sorry – which is especially true when you’re talking about a business that could represent your life’s work.

First take stock of what risks are inherent in your business. A bookstore will not need the same coverage as a meat cutting plant. More injuries to employees and possible food poisoning to customers is a real possibility at a plant but not in a bookstore. Do not necessarily enlist a company that offers small business liability insurance at a low price solely based on this fee. To do so might tie you to a company that will not be in business when a claim is filed. Find a financially strong company by investigating company statements online for the most comprehensive small business liability insurance at a reasonable price.

Make sure the cheap small business insurance company is familiar with your industry. It is not wise to enlist a company that is not familiar with the pitfalls prevalent in your industry. A good small business liability insurance company will be easily accessible and not stonewall you when you have questions.

Your coverage in a retail establishment should cover injuries to customers that are injured on the property. Most important is to have product liability coverage. If you sell the item that injures a customer, you could be liable for the item. This applies even if the product was manufactured elsewhere, even offshore. Be vigilant and discriminating when seeking business liability insurance.

Tips that can help save money on van insurance

You will find that these simple tips can help save money on your van insurance quote. I share these few tips that can potentially save you money and get you a lower can insurance premium.

Make sure that the driver of your van does not have any driving convictions as this can increase the cost of your premium considerably. Also make sure that the driver is aged over twenty five years old, otherwise the insurance company will categorize them as being a high risk driver that will also increase the price of the premium.

When filling in the online form always be honest and disclose the correct information concerning the driver, if you lie of mislead the insurance company when making a claim they may refuse to pay out any money when you have to make a claim.

Having an alarm or immobilizer installed on your van will also help reduce the price of the premium. Most insurers will offer you a discount for this because you are securing your van against theft and not making a claim which in turn means the insurance company will not have to pay out any money.

Consider changing your van to a lower weight class as this can save you money. Do you really need a big van with a large engine cc? You should always review and assess your current needs, as you could be paying for insurance on a vehicle that is not meeting your needs.
